Bybit to Delist RNDR Perpetual Futures on July 22

Bybit, a leading cryptocurrency exchange, has announced that it will delist the RNDR/USDT perpetual futures trading pair on July 22 at 17:00 (Korean time). The decision was made due to low trading volume and liquidity for the pair. RNDR is a decentralized rendering network that uses blockchain technology to connect users with computing resources. The RNDR token is used to pay for rendering services on the network. Bybit will cease trading for the RNDR/USDT perpetual futures pair at the specified time. Any open positions in the pair will be closed automatically. Users are advised to withdraw their funds from the pair before the delisting takes effect.
